About this item
One of John Philip Sousa's most famous marches arranged here by David Andrew. The counter-melody in the flute part can be played on (or doubled by) a piccolo if one is available.
Instrumentation
2 Flutes, 2 Oboes, 2 Clarinets in Bb, 2 Bassoons 2 Horns in F or Eb, 2 Trumpets in Bb, 3 Trombones, Tuba, Timpani, Percussion (Glockenspiel, Triangle, Snare drum, Cymbals, Bass drum) Strings (Violin 1, Violin 2, Viola, Cello, Bass)

Composer
John Philip Sousa (1854-1932)

John Philip Sousa (November 6, 1854 – March 6, 1932) was an American composer and conductor of the late Romantic era, known particularly for American military and patriotic marches. Because of his mastery of march composition, he is known as "The March King" or the "American March King" due to his British counterpart Kenneth J. Alford also being known as "The March King". Among his best known marches are "The Washington Post", "Semper Fidelis" (Official March of the United States Marine Corps), and "The Stars and Stripes Forever" (National March of the United States of America)
